2026 Wedding Trends: Color Palettes, Quiet Luxury, Microweddings & Floral Style

Curious what 2026 Wedding Trends will look like? Well look no further! At Elevations Design Co., we’re seeing clear themes emerge — from refined color schemes to timeless florals that allow couples to express their unique style. We are also seeing brides scale back in some areas to have the aesthetic they want, without stretching their budget.

As we step into 2026, weddings are becoming more intentional, elevated, and deeply personal. Brides are embracing intimate celebrations, thoughtful details, and designs that feel both luxurious and grounded. Ready to check them out? Me too- Let’s dive in!


1. 2026 Weddings will Boast Elevated Color Palettes: Earthy, Moody & Touches of Opulence.

2026 wedding trends include adding pops of metallic colors such as gold or champagne. This Bride and groom are dressed in classic bridal attire while the bride wears gold high heels
Pops of metallic golds and champagnes are on trend in 2026

Color is taking center stage in 2026 weddings, with brides choosing palettes that feel rich, warm, and sophisticated.

Top Trending Wedding Color Schemes for 2026

  • Moody Romantic: Merlot, deep plum, and espresso brown, layered with soft mauves or dusty rose.
  • Earthy Elegance: Terracotta, olive, and warm neutrals inspired by natural landscapes continue to shine.
  • Modern Quiet Luxury: Classic Ivory, cream, taupe, soft gold tones, champagne, and eucalyptus green — understated yet stunning.
  • Bold-but-Soft: Slate blue, steel gray, and warm beige creating a calm but modern palette.
  • Elevated Boho: Earthy textures, greenery, and colors ranging from warm beige to merlot create an organic but refined and modern version of the trend that has been sweeping the wedding industry for the past few years.

These palettes align beautifully with the quiet luxury movement — offering richness without feeling loud or trendy.


2. 2026 Wedding Trends Continue to see The Rise of Microweddings, Elopements & Intimate Celebrations

Intimate Elopements and Microweddings are a popular choice as couples choose to spend their budgets on curated details

Since 2025, intimate weddings have transformed from a budget decision into an intentional design choice. For 2026, microweddings and small-scale celebrations continue to grow in popularity.

Why Intimate Weddings Are In

  • Couples want experiences that feel deeply personal, meaningful, and guest-focused.
  • Brides are seeking a quiet luxury aesthetic, from bespoke floral design to curated details. Think quality over quantity.
  • Higher-quality vendor experiences with more time and attention from each professional.
  • Budgets stretch farther. Couples are being more discerning about how they are investing their money. Many are choosing more elevated details without the cost of 200+ guests.
  • Less stress. Couples want to enjoy their family and closest friends

3. Quiet Luxury: The Defining Aesthetic of 2026 Weddings

A top 2026 wedding trend is a quiet luxury aesthetic. This Bride looks radiant in a classic long sleeve lace sheath dress.
Brides are choosing Quiet Luxury for events in 2026

If 2026 had a signature style, it would be quiet luxury.

Think:

  • Clean lines
  • Timeless florals
  • Elevated neutrals
  • High-quality textures
  • Understated elegance

Brides are moving away from overly trendy and cheap decor, and choosing designs that feel classic, curated, and deeply personal. Florals are becoming sculptural and intentional, using seasonal blooms and monochromatic palettes to create calm, cohesive beauty.

This aesthetic pairs perfectly with modern venues, estate weddings, art-inspired spaces, and luxe but minimal outdoor settings.


4. Smart Wedding Budgets: “Intentional Spending” Is the New Trend

Budget-conscious brides aren’t cutting style — they’re reallocating! As a floral designer who also happens to be a financial coach, I am here for it!

2026 brides are prioritizing:

  • Gorgeous Floral Designs
  • Photography
  • Personal experiences and connecting with those closest to them
  • Food and Drinks that are an authentic reflection of the couple
  • Aesthetic elements that show up in photos
  • Bespoke cakes with non-traditional flavors, multi-tiered cakes with different flavors in each layer, or cakes adorned with fruit. 

Where they’re saving:

  • Smaller bridal parties
  • Repurposing ceremony florals for the reception
  • Renting instead of purchasing décor
  • Smaller more intimate guest lists and receptions
  • Skipping traditional “must haves” like centerpieces on every reception table

Florals, in particular, are viewed as an investment — one that impacts the entire feel and visual story of the wedding day.


5. Floral Trends for 2026: Color, Texture & Full of Movement

Flowers in a romantic moody color palette of burgundy, deep purple and greenery are on trend in 2026
Gorgeous florals in moody burgundy, deep purple and lush green jewel tones are on trend in 2026

At Elevations Design Co., we’re seeing a strong shift toward florals that feel organic, airy, and editorial. Florals, in particular, are viewed as an investment — one that impacts the entire feel and visual story of the wedding day. We are also seeing a rise in requested luxury blooms such as peonies and dahlias that make a big impact.

Top Floral Trends

  • Textural Blooms: Grasses, pods, herbs, and unique greenery add depth and dimension.
  • Modern Garden Style: A balance of structured design with natural movement.
  • Monochromatic Palettes: One-color floral palettes in layered tones feel chic, calm, and elevated.
  • Statement Pieces Over Quantity: Brides are skipping centerpeieces on every table and opting for larger, high-impact statement pieces.
  • Repurposing Florals Throughout the Day: Ceremony arrangements are getting a second life at the reception — a smart and beautiful budget-friendly trend!

Florals, in particular, are viewed as an investment — one that impacts the entire feel and visual story of the wedding day. Instead of florals everywhere, brides are choosing a more refined, upscale aesthetic such as:

  • One major floral installation
  • A lush ceremony arch or statement pieces
  • A dramatic bridal bouquet
  • Scaled back, intentional reception florals
  • An uptick in luxury blooms such as garden roses, peonies, and dahlias that make a big impact
